Gentoo Archives: gentoo-commits

From: Mike Frysinger <vapier@g.o>
To: gentoo-commits@l.g.o
Subject: [gentoo-commits] proj/catalyst:master commit in: catalyst/base/
Date: Sun, 11 Oct 2015 17:26:48
Message-Id: 1444521277.4f358eec1331b8facdbdc7eb36bfd702fd31ad29.vapier@gentoo
1 commit: 4f358eec1331b8facdbdc7eb36bfd702fd31ad29
2 Author: Mike Frysinger <vapier <AT> gentoo <DOT> org>
3 AuthorDate: Sat Oct 10 05:15:43 2015 +0000
4 Commit: Mike Frysinger <vapier <AT> gentoo <DOT> org>
5 CommitDate: Sat Oct 10 23:54:37 2015 +0000
6 URL: https://gitweb.gentoo.org/proj/catalyst.git/commit/?id=4f358eec
7
8 clearbase: convert to log module
9
10 catalyst/base/clearbase.py | 21 +++++++++++----------
11 1 file changed, 11 insertions(+), 10 deletions(-)
12
13 diff --git a/catalyst/base/clearbase.py b/catalyst/base/clearbase.py
14 index b2c1a11..3817196 100644
15 --- a/catalyst/base/clearbase.py
16 +++ b/catalyst/base/clearbase.py
17 @@ -1,5 +1,6 @@
18
19
20 +from catalyst import log
21 from catalyst.support import countdown
22 from catalyst.fileops import clear_dir
23
24 @@ -15,38 +16,38 @@ class ClearBase(object):
25 def clear_autoresume(self):
26 """ Clean resume points since they are no longer needed """
27 if "autoresume" in self.settings["options"]:
28 - print "Removing AutoResume Points: ..."
29 + log.notice('Removing AutoResume Points ...')
30 self.resume.clear_all()
31
32
33 def remove_autoresume(self):
34 """ Rmove all resume points since they are no longer needed """
35 if "autoresume" in self.settings["options"]:
36 - print "Removing AutoResume: ..."
37 + log.notice('Removing AutoResume ...')
38 self.resume.clear_all(remove=True)
39
40
41 def clear_chroot(self):
42 self.chroot_lock.unlock()
43 - print 'Clearing the chroot path ...'
44 + log.notice('Clearing the chroot path ...')
45 clear_dir(self.settings["chroot_path"], 0755, True)
46
47
48 def remove_chroot(self):
49 self.chroot_lock.unlock()
50 - print 'Removing the chroot path ...'
51 + log.notice('Removing the chroot path ...')
52 clear_dir(self.settings["chroot_path"], 0755, True, remove=True)
53
54
55 def clear_packages(self, remove=False):
56 if "pkgcache" in self.settings["options"]:
57 - print "purging the pkgcache ..."
58 + log.notice('purging the pkgcache ...')
59 clear_dir(self.settings["pkgcache_path"], remove=remove)
60
61
62 def clear_kerncache(self, remove=False):
63 if "kerncache" in self.settings["options"]:
64 - print "purging the kerncache ..."
65 + log.notice('purging the kerncache ...')
66 clear_dir(self.settings["kerncache_path"], remove=remove)
67
68
69 @@ -54,15 +55,15 @@ class ClearBase(object):
70 countdown(10,"Purging Caches ...")
71 if any(k in self.settings["options"] for k in ("purge",
72 "purgeonly", "purgetmponly")):
73 - print "purge(); clearing autoresume ..."
74 + log.notice('purge(); clearing autoresume ...')
75 self.clear_autoresume()
76
77 - print "purge(); clearing chroot ..."
78 + log.notice('purge(); clearing chroot ...')
79 self.clear_chroot()
80
81 if "purgetmponly" not in self.settings["options"]:
82 - print "purge(); clearing package cache ..."
83 + log.notice('purge(); clearing package cache ...')
84 self.clear_packages(remove)
85
86 - print "purge(); clearing kerncache ..."
87 + log.notice('purge(); clearing kerncache ...')
88 self.clear_kerncache(remove)